Building on the success of the 2011 edition, this year’s Beeston CC Sportive was even better, with a total of 189 entrants. The initial feedback from the event was very good and organisers are collating as much feedback so that they can make the 2013 event even better.

After completing the 24 June event one happy rider commented, “Totally loved every mile (even the rain at the start), met some great people. Can’t wait until next year. Only one comment - Rowsley Bar OMG ! and I thought the Weaver Hill climb in the CC Giro Midland Monster was hard.”

Another rider commented: “I cannot put down the list of superlatives for the way you and the team ran the event – other than simply a massive thank you to all.”

However, Beeston CC isn’t a club to rest easy on its laurels, admitting that micro chip timing is one way that it could deal with the increasing rider numbers whilst keeping the rider experience slick. Yet Beeston CC is keen to “that club feel”, with local route knowledge and friendly, human-scale service. “Our aim is to be the must attend club event that mixes hospitality with a real challenge,” said Andy, the event organiser.

Andy also praised the service that the club received from British Cycling in the lead-up to their event. “It was seamless, efficient and helped us have the space and time to concentrate on making the event a success.”

Summing up, the organising team was really pleased with the way the event went. “We really appreciated the support of all the entrants,” concluded Andy, “However, we are keen to hear any feedback to help us improve the event further next year.”
